일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- SEO
- HttpSession
- 워드프레스
- Polylang
- router
- db
- firebase
- linkedhastset
- GA4
- Thymeleaf
- GET
- 구글애널리틱스
- JPA
- post
- mergeattributes()
- set
- @Repository
- addallattributes()
- 데이터베이스
- @Controller
- 인텔리제이
- 플러그인
- Login
- @Entity
- 구글
- @Query
- useEffect
- 리액트오류
- 구글알고리즘
- ChatGPT
- Today
- Total
목록firebase (3)
개발천재

CORS는 웹 브라우저에서 도메인이 다른 서버끼리 서로 요청을 주고 받을 수 있게끔 해주는 것 CORS 이해하기CORS(Cross-Origin Resource Sharing)는 웹 브라우저에서 다른 출처의 리소스를 요청할 수 있도록 허용하는 것을 말한다. 웹 애플리케이션은 보안을 위해 기본적으로 동일 출처 정책(Same-Origin Policy)을 따르는데, 이 정책에 따라 한 웹 페이지가 다른 출처의 리소스에 접근하려고 하면 제한이 발생한다. CORS는 이 제한을 허용할 수 있도록 한다. example.com 이라는 집이 있다고 가정해보자. example.com이라는 집은 그 집에 사는 사람만 들어갈 수 있다. 다른 사람은 허락 없이 들어올 수 없다. 그런데 만약에 example.com에 살고 있는 ..

firebase tool 설치하기리액트 프로젝트를 firebase 호스팅에 배포하기 위해서는 firebase CLI(Firebase 명령어 도구)를 설치해야한다. 설치는 터미널에서 아래 명령어를 실행해서 설치할 수 있다.npm install -g firebase-tools 아래 명령어를 입력하여 firebase에 로그인하고, 질문이 나오면 n을 입력하고 엔터를 누른다.firebase 프로젝트에 접근하려면 로그인을 해야하는데 아래 명령어를 실행하면 구글 계정으로 로그인할 수 있다. firebase loginAllow Firebase to collect CLI and Emulator Suite usage and error reporting information? (Y/n) n웹사이트 창이 열리면서 계정을 ..

리액트에서 firebase SDK 설치하기터미널에서 아래의 코드를 입력하여 firebase SDK를 설치한다.npm install firebase src 폴더 안에 firebase.js 파일을 생성하고 Firebase 설정 코드를 추가한다.설정코드는 firebase에서 프로젝트를 생성하고 설정을 완료하면 제공된다.(문서 하단 참조)// src/firebase.jsimport { initializeApp } from "firebase/app";import { getAuth } from "firebase/auth";import { getFirestore } from "firebase/firestore";// Firebase 설정 객체const firebaseConfig = { apiKey: "YOUR_A..